Abstract

Background: Deep vein thrombosis (DVT) is a great postoperative challenge in all orthopaedic surgeries. To the authors’ knowledge, this study is the first to evaluate the efficacy of aspirin administration in the prevention of DVT in patients undergoing lumbar spinal surgery. Methods: In this double-blind parallel randomized clinical trial, a total of 126 candidates (age 40 yr and older) were admitted between June 2021 to December 2021. Patients were randomly assigned to the intervention chemoprophylaxis group (41 patients receiving 325 mg aspirin) and controls. The DVT occurrence was recorded by clinical features (Well’s criteria), Doppler lower limbs ultrasound, and D-dimer levels in all participants at baseline (24 hr before the time of surgery) and 2, 6, and 12 wk after surgery in postoperative visits. Results: The mean age of the participants was 63.72±6.87 yr. Baseline demographic values were similar in both groups (P>0.05). The mean follow-up duration was 6.11±2.33 mo. No cases of DVT or abnormal findings on Doppler ultrasound were observed in either group. The mean duration of hospitalization or intensive care unit (ICU) admission was similar between the two groups. Mean baseline D-dimer levels were significantly higher in the intervention group compared with the controls (P=0.047), while it was similar in both groups 3 mo after the operation (P=0.13). Conclusions: In the current study, no case of DVT was observed in either study group. These data do not support the use of aspirin as an anticoagulant for DVT prophylaxis following regular lumbar spinal surgeries. Level of Evidence: Level II.
